Hi, I was told that I would be going out on a business visa and an initial 6 month contract as the approved headcount had been exceeded and it would save delay in waiting for next financial period approvals. I was told his is not uncommon and that I would transfer onto a work visa after arrival and contract amended accordingly.

Hi. I'm on a BVV now. It is good for a year and you do have to exit and re-enter the country at least every 90 days. That said, a trip up to Aqaba or taking the flight to Dammam and heading to Bahrain is pretty easy and not a bad thing to do regularly any way.
As for getting your work visa, you have to lodge from a country where you have legal residence (KSA won't count). So it doesn't necessarily have to be the country of your passport, but you do have to be able to show residence. Just because you have a BVV will not abridge your work visa process. You will still need to get your degrees verified, do medical, get criminal background and everything else that is on the list -- this includes getting verified Neom Contract, Neom POA, etc from government affairs. Finally, when you leave KSA to get your work visa, you will have to cancel you BVV. You will need to get a document from Neom to do this. This is all do-able, but does take a bit of planning and good communication with your visa agent. Finally, I'd check with your onboarder if the company will pay for your flight to lodge your work visa or if you will have to go back at your own expense. |
